Taotao Fu is a scholar working on Biomedical Engineering, Computational Mechanics and Electrical and Electronic Engineering. According to data from OpenAlex, Taotao Fu has authored 206 papers receiving a total of 3.8k indexed citations (citations by other indexed papers that have themselves been cited), including 182 papers in Biomedical Engineering, 67 papers in Computational Mechanics and 62 papers in Electrical and Electronic Engineering. Recurrent topics in Taotao Fu’s work include Innovative Microfluidic and Catalytic Techniques Innovation (147 papers), Fluid Dynamics and Mixing (57 papers) and Microfluidic and Capillary Electrophoresis Applications (54 papers). Taotao Fu is often cited by papers focused on Innovative Microfluidic and Catalytic Techniques Innovation (147 papers), Fluid Dynamics and Mixing (57 papers) and Microfluidic and Capillary Electrophoresis Applications (54 papers). Taotao Fu collaborates with scholars based in China, France and Russia. Taotao Fu's co-authors include Youguang Ma, Chunying Zhu, Huai Li, Denis Fünfschilling, Yining Wu, Shaokun Jiang, Yaran Yin, Rongwei Guo, Xiaoda Wang and Wei Du and has published in prestigious journals such as Analytical Chemistry, Langmuir and Chemical Engineering Journal.
